Output 51effeffba1aa8ece4a1a788c3772cfa776fc7e6ee948ee78d821fe931324c94:23

value
1676891
script pubkey
OP_0 OP_PUSHBYTES_20 c1d14aaa34ebb6a0b546882d56194efe67aeab01
address
bc1qc8g54235awm2pd2x3qk4vx2wlen6a2cplrrqr0
transaction
51effeffba1aa8ece4a1a788c3772cfa776fc7e6ee948ee78d821fe931324c94
spent
true